The National Institute of Mental Health (NIMH) seeks to support innovative educational activities focused on proposed skill development courses for graduate/medical students, medical residents, postdoctoral scholars, and/or early-career investigators to advance its mission by continuing the NIMH Research Education Program. Applications should propose to develop, implement, and evaluate creative and innovative short courses that will provide education in state-of-the-art research skills (e.g., tools, techniques, and approaches). Applications are not being solicited at this time. This notice is being issued to provide potential applicants ample time to develop strong, responsive applications. Investigators with expertise and insights in the development, implementation, and evaluation of innovative and interactive short courses for scientists interested in learning state-of-the-art skills needed to conduct cutting-edge mental health research are encouraged to consider applying to the NOFO.
